What is cell engineering?

Cell engineering is a multidisciplinary field that involves modifying and manipulating cells to enhance their functions or to produce desired biological products. This can include genetic engineering, synthetic biology, and tissue engineering techniques to improve cell performance for applications in medicine, research, or industry. Professionals in cell engineering work on developing therapies, improving disease models, or creating cells that can produce valuable compounds, such as proteins or vaccines. The field is rapidly growing and plays a crucial role in advancements like cell-based therapies, regenerative medicine, and biomanufacturing.

What is the difference between Cell Engineering vs Cell Biologist?

AspectCell EngineeringCell Biologist
Required CredentialsDegree in bioengineering, biotechnology, or related fields; often includes lab certificationsDegree in biology, molecular biology, or related fields; research experience common
Work EnvironmentLaboratories focused on genetic modification, synthetic biology, and bioprocessingResearch labs, academic institutions, and healthcare settings
Employer & Industry UsageBiotech companies, pharmaceutical firms, research institutionsUniversities, research institutes, healthcare organizations

Cell Engineering involves designing and modifying cells for specific applications like drug production or tissue engineering, often requiring engineering skills. Cell Biologists focus on understanding cell functions and processes through research. While both roles work in lab settings and require biology backgrounds, Cell Engineering emphasizes applied bioengineering techniques, whereas Cell Biology centers on fundamental research.

Wood Applied Intelligence -Automation and Controls is currently recruiting for a Vision Applications Engineer in Wixom, MI.ย 

Vision applications engineers design and integrate vision systems in automation facilities.

Typical vision systems use cameras and sensors to perform the following:

Code Readers - Reading 1D and 2D codes marked directly on a part Error Proofing - Verifying the components are correctly assembled Sorting - Different parts from each other or good form defective parts Gauging - Measuring parts and analyzing them to a specification Robot Guidance - Guiding the pick & place
